Serenity bdd que es
WebOct 21, 2024 · I'm new to Serenity BDD and not sure why my test is running always on Firefox with the code I have attached. Adding a web driver variable annotated with … Web¿Qué es Appium? Automatización con Appium y Serenity BDD Parte 1
Serenity bdd que es
Did you know?
WebNov 10, 2024 · Serenity BDD is an open-source library that aims to make the idea of living documentation a reality. Serenity BDD helps you write cleaner and more maintainable automated acceptance and regression tests faster. WebMay 22, 2024 · Serenity BDD is the framework supporting 3 different approaches: Cucumber: same features as stand-alone cucumber, can work with UI or API Automation Page Object: works with UI automation (selenium) Screenplay: a design pattern for UI and API automation Serenity BDD does many things for auto testers that:
WebFeb 23, 2024 · In this tutorial, we'll give an introduction to Serenity BDD – a great tool for applying Behaviour Driven Development (BDD). This is a solution for automated … WebSerenity BDD is a test automation library designed to make writing automated acceptance tests easier, and more fun. - GitHub - serenity-bdd/serenity-core: Serenity …
WebSe muestra cómo iniciar con el proyecto de Serenity Bdd y el patrón ScreenPlay para la realización de pruebas web.En este video veremos que es un Fact en Ser... WebSerenity BDD Mentoring, Support and Assistance More and more teams are using Serenity BDD to fast-track their test automation efforts and to get the benefits of a reliable, high quality, and highly maintainable automated test suite sooner. But teams adopting modern automated testing practices often face challenges to bring team members up to speed.
Es una librería de código abierto que ayuda a escribir pruebas de aceptación automatizadas de mayor calidad y más rápido. Sus principales características son: 1. Escribir test flexibles y fáciles de mantener 2. Generar informes ilustrativos sobre las pruebas 3. Ajustar las pruebas automatizadas a las … See more Esta pregunta me la hacía cuando estaba realizando la investigación sobre Serenity BDD, ¿Dónde queda Cucumber? ¿ya no lo usamos?. A lo que concluyo que Cucumber está inmerso en Serenity, podemos hacer la … See more Se necesita validar que al ingresar una palabra en Inglés en Google Traslate esta palabra quede correctamente traducida en español. Paso 1: Verificar Gradle y Cucumber Para este … See more
WebSerenity BDD helps you write better, more effective automated acceptance tests, and use these acceptance tests to produce world-class test reports and living documentation. Learn more about Serenity BDD Learn Serenity BDD online at your own pace What is Serenity? Define your requirements and acceptance criteria attack on titan tastaturWebFeb 12, 2016 · 1. Instead of directly using only Maven install to drive the tests, use Junit or TestNG along with it to do that. If you use Junit, timeout could be done as: @Test (timeout = 20) public void try () { while (true); } TestNG also works almost the same way: @Test (timeOut = 10000) public void try () { while (true); } attack on titan tattoo erenWebMar 29, 2024 · Using the plugins DSL: plugins { id "net.serenity-bdd.serenity-gradle-plugin" version "3.6.22" } Using legacy plugin application: buildscript { repositories { maven ... fzn1WebOct 1, 2024 · Another common problem is corporate proxies messing around with SSL certificates, which you can avoid by instructing serenity-bdd to ignore any invalid certs: "postinstall": "serenity-bdd update --ignoreSSL" Hope this helps! Jan. Share. Follow edited Oct 2, 2024 at 22:32. answered ... attack on titan tattoo leviWebJun 20, 2024 · 2. In the Serenity BDD you can write a Question class that: import static net.thucydides.core.webdriver.ThucydidesWebDriverSupport.getDriver; implements Question < Boolean >. in it would be the method: @Override public Boolean answeredBy (Actor actor) {. and in it you can: WebDriver driver = getDriver (); String currentUrl = … fzn053WebAug 18, 2016 · Modify build Gradle settings to generate your own "serenity-report-resources" jar file. Open the "build.gradle" file. 2.1 Add "mavenLocal ()" to the repositories: buildscript { repositories { mavenLocal () ..... 2.2 Add Maven publish plugin. apply plugin: 'maven-publish'. 2.3 Change the subproject version number. Replace the line: fzn ffWebSerenity BDD is a simple but powerful way to get into automated acceptance testing and BDD-style living documentation. Watch John Ferguson Smart, founder and lead … fzn selm